#d6ec60 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d6ec60 is composed of 83.9% red, 92.5%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 9.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 59.3% yellow and 7.5% black. It has a hue angle of 69.4 degrees, a saturation of 78.7% and a lightness of 65.1%. #d6ec60 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ffc0 with #add900. Closest websafe color is: #ccff66.

Shades and Tints of #d6ec60

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e1002 is the darkest color, while #fffff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#d6ec60

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a7a8a4 is the less saturated color, while #dffa52 is the most saturated one.
